What is the past tense of procrastinate?

What's the past tense of procrastinate? Here's the word you're looking for.

Answer

The past tense of procrastinate is procrastinated.

The third-person singular simple present indicative form of procrastinate is procrastinates.

The present participle of procrastinate is procrastinating.

The past participle of procrastinate is procrastinated.
